自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 JavaScript中关于数据类型的细节(下)

我们继续讨论在JavaScript中的数据类型。继Number之后就是另外两个非常重要的String类型和Object类型。 3.String类型 ECMAScript中规定字符串是不可变的,字符串一旦创建它的值是不能改变的,如果需要改变则需要另外创建字符串,去除改变之前的字符串,再创建新的字符串覆盖之前的字符串。以下例子 var str = 'nihao' str = str+'zhongguo...

2019-12-15 21:18:33 101

原创 JavaScript中关于数据类型的细节(上)

这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入 欢迎使用Ma...

2019-12-15 20:25:23 167

原创 你还在使用!importent 打补丁吗

!importent对于像我这种菜鸟来说是非常重要的一个属性,因为对于css样式的掌握不够,所以想要在大量的css代码中做到样式不重叠,这个属性总是或多或少的在我的代码中出现。 但是大佬们再三叮嘱:“这个属性是不到万一不能用的杀手锏”,如果频繁使用造成的样式混乱是难以估量的。避免使用!importent对于代码的可维护性至关重要。为了向大佬们看齐,不得不舍弃这个杀手锏,但是样式权重的问题如何才能解...

2019-12-04 23:32:21 405

原创 JavaScript中的原型概念

JavaScript中原型的存在很大程度上是对于内存的节省,因为如果JavaScript中没有原型的设定,就会有大量的方法根据实例的创建而创建,而很多的方法是该实例并不需要的但依然会被创建,每一个方法的创建都会开辟一个新的空间,这是对内存的极大消耗。 所以方法只存在于构造函数中,哪一个实例需要再去创建的想法就产生了,进而出现了原型这个概念 构造函数通过原型分配的函数是对所有对象共享的,不用再单独开...

2019-10-08 21:20:09 194 1

原创 JavaScript中的this指向问题

JavaScript中的this指向一直是前端面试中的高频考题,在日常的工作学习中this的指向问题也会伴随着各种问题的出现,今天我们来详细讨论一下JavaScript中的this 1.首先是在全局作用域下的this指向的就是window对象,如下代码所示 var username = '新垣结衣'; function getName(){ console.log(this.username) ...

2019-10-08 19:16:52 235 1

原创 在node.js中的mongodb的简单使用

mongodb数据库是web应用比较常见使用的数据库,mongodb最大的特点就是其增删改查的语言不是传统的sql语句,而是与面向对象的语言的语句很相似。 其中表的概念在mongodb中称之为集合,是数据的容器,首先就是创建一个集合。 1.在模块中引入const mongoose = require('mongoose');(当然这个模块需要提前下载好) 2.在当前项目中与数据库进行连接 mong...

2019-10-08 18:07:18 118

原创 JavaScript中三种动态创建元素的区别

## JavaScript中三种动态创建元素的区别 在我们的页面中,有一些元素是不能在html中直接创建的,需要在JavaScript中动态的创建元素,在JavaScript中动态创建元素有几种常用的方法: 1.document.write() 2.element.innerHTML 3.document.createElement() 接下来分别介绍一下这几种方法,以及他们的适用的一些场景 do...

2019-08-28 23:00:21 346

原创 使用图标字体的方法

在我们的页面布局中,使用图标字体可以说是我们前端人员必须要学会的基本功,但是图标文字的使用可不是简单的代码能写出来的,需要诸多的操作。 首先大部分初学者有一个问题 图标字体到底是图还是字呢? 我能明确回答,是字,是图一样的字(一句废话) 那这些字有什么独特之处呢? 看下面的图片,这些就是图标文字,看着像图片实际兼具文字的特性 这些图标字体字的优点有什么呢? 有图片一样的效果,但是还可以随意改变颜...

2019-08-07 23:02:19 311

原创 清除浮动

在写CSS代码的过程中,几乎每一个朋友都遇到过关于清除浮动的问题,但是为什么要清除浮动,在什么情况下清除浮动,清除浮动有哪些方法,都是很让人挠头的问题 今天我们就来详细的讨论一下清除浮动的相关内容。 首先我们为什么要清除浮动? 在我们开发的过程中,盒子的嵌套是非常常见的,但是通常父盒子的高度我们是不会指定的,因为我们也不知道我们的父盒子里面要包括多少的内容,父盒子的高度是里面的子盒子来决定的,而子...

2019-08-07 22:05:47 88

原创 外边距塌陷

对于前端新手来说,写的好好的CSS代码,显示在网页上的样子却惨不忍睹,各种各样的bug层出不穷,前不久就遇到一个相当棘手的问题。 需求就是想要这个图片上的橙色盒子的位置在蓝色盒子里面偏下一点,在橙色盒子上添加了margin-top=30px; 利用margin顶开一定的距离。 理想情况是这样的: 但是出现了出现了神奇的一幕 距离没有拉开反而蓝色的盒子也被带下来了。 后来查了才知道遇到了令人...

2019-08-07 21:31:07 143

原创 删除链表中的元素(迭代)

删除链表中的元素(迭代删除) 刚刚学习数据结构,在LeetCode中遇到一个删除链表中元素的题目 如下: 删除链表中等于给定值 val 的所有节点。 示例: 输入: 1->2->6->3->4->5->6, val = 6 输出: 1->2->3->4->5 来源:力扣(LeetCode) 链接:https://leetcode-cn.c...

2019-07-11 16:38:30 539

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除